2. Participation

The World Senior Team Chess Championship is open to all players, regardless of rating and title, who reach their age of 50 and 65 by 31st December 2025 and represent National Chess Federations which are members of FIDE. Teams can register only through their national chess federations. There is no limit in the number of teams per federation (club teams, city teams, regional teams, national teams, etc. may start in the championship, there is no limitation). There is only one limitation – all team players must be members of the same chess federation (for example CZE).

According to the FIDE tournament rules, the World Championship will be played in four categories: age 50+ and 65+ (Open and women). A separate tournament will take place only with a minimum of 10 teams from at least 2 continents. If these conditions are not met, then the teams may participate in the corresponding age category in the Open Section, or (in case of Women 65+), they can take part in the Women’s section 50+.

All teams are obliged to be accommodated in one of the official hotels through the organizer.

7. Rules and regulations

The FIDE Tournament Rules should be followed.

The championship will be played by a 9-rounds Swiss system.

It will be played on 4 chessboards with 1 allowed reserve player (teams can consist of 4 or 5 members).

The time control is 90 minutes/40 moves + 30 minutes for the rest of the game + 30 sec for each move from the first move.

Default time for all 9 rounds is 30 minutes.

9. Appeals procedure

A protest against the decision of an Arbiter must be submitted in writing to the Chief Arbiter, within 30 minutes after the end of the game. A protest fee of 200 Euro has to be paid to FIDE and it is refundable if the protest is upheld. The Appeals Committee may also decide to refund the fee if it considers the appeal was not frivolous.

10. Tie-break criteria

  1. number of match points (win = 2 points, draw 1 point, lost game 0 points)
  2. number of game points (score)
  3. mutual game
  4. Buchholz Cut 1
  5. Buchholz
  6. Sonneborn-Berger

The team with a free lot will obtain 2 match points and 50% of points to the score. If the opponent default the match, the team will obtain 2 match points and 100% of points to the score.

Prizes for teams, which get the same number of match points and game points, are distributed according to the Hort system (among such number of teams which corresponds to the number of advertised prizes).
